Posteado por: basicamente | julio 9, 2007

Howto instalar Lm-sensors

Hoy os voy a explicar como podéis monitorizar todos los parámetros de vuestra computadora en la barra del menú del escritorio. Estes no son sensores como los que puedes poner por defecto en Ubuntu de la frecuencia de la CPU y la cantidad de memoria en uso sino que te indican la temperatura de chipset, cpu, voltaje de la fuente de alimentación y revoluciones de los ventiladores.

En primer lugar tenemos que mirar si nuestro modelo de chipset está soportado en esta página.

Si, como en mi caso, tenemos un chipset soportado, pasamos ya a la instalación y configuración:

En primer lugar tenemos que instalar los sensores:

$ sudo aptitude install lm-sensors

Ahora tenéis que crear un archivo en vuestra carpeta personal (/home/tu_nombre/) llamado mkdev.sh y pegad el siguiente código:

#!/bin/bash
# Here you can set several defaults.
# The number of devices to create (max: 256)
NUMBER=32
# The owner and group of the devices
OUSER=root
OGROUP=root
# The mode of the devices
MODE=600
# This script doesn’t need to be run if devfs is used
if [ -r /proc/mounts ] ; then
if grep -q “/dev devfs” /proc/mounts ; then
echo “You do not need to run this script as your system uses devfs.”
exit;
fi
fi
i=0;
while [ $i -lt $NUMBER ] ; do
echo /dev/i2c-$i
mknod -m $MODE /dev/i2c-$i c 89 $i || exit
chown “$OUSER:$OGROUP” /dev/i2c-$i || exit
i=$[$i + 1]
done
#end of file

Guardad el archivo y ahora lo hacemos ejecutable dándole permisos:

$ chmod 755 mkdev.sh

Ahora ejecutamos sensors-detect:

$ sudo sensors-detect

Solo nos queda darle a enter hasta que nos aparezca el siguiente mensaje “Do you want to add these lines to /etc/modules automatically?”, pues justo antes de eso os va a salira algo como lo siguiente:

#—-cut here—-
# I2C adapter drivers
# modprobe unknown adapter NVIDIA i2c adapter 0 at 1:00.0
# modprobe unknown adapter NVIDIA i2c adapter 1 at 1:00.0
# modprobe unknown adapter NVIDIA i2c adapter 2 at 1:00.0
i2c-piix4
# Chip drivers
eeprom
smsc47m192
k8temp
smsc47m1
#—-cut here—-

Bien, pues lo copiais y vamos a editar /etc/modules y para ello:

$ sudo gedit /etc/modules

Y ahí pegas todo lo anterior (si quieres acabar rápido, porque todo lo que está precedido por # son aclaraciones) o copias solo lo que no tiene las # delante.

Para probarlos ya, tenéis que introducir los siguiente, pero con los módulos que os salió a vosotros:

$ sudo modprobe i2c-piix4

$ sudo modprobe eeprom

$ sudo modprobe smsc47m192

$ sudo modprobe k8temp

$ sudo modprobe smsc47m1

Ahora solo nos queda hacer que salga en el menú (si queremos) aunque ya funcionan mediante consola al meter el comando: “$ sensors” y os saldrá un texto con las mediciones de ese instante en vuestro PC.

Para añadirlos al menú seguid los siguientes pasos:

Instalad mediante Synaptic el “gnome sensors applet”.

Ahora solo os queda añadir el applet al menú y en la configuración del mismo podréis configurar los sensores que quereis que se muestren. Por ejemplo yo tengo la temperatura de la CPU y del chipset junto a las rpm de los ventiladores.

lm-sensors

Información sacada del blog “Entre tuxes y pepinos”.

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

Categorías

A %d blogueros les gusta esto: